The final four models meet Thai designer Pichita Rucksajit who sends them on a challenge to travel via 'tuk tuk' (Thai taxis) to meet and impress local designers; after which the girls fly to Phuket where Tyra talks about the Tsunami to remind them of the importance of respecting local history and culture when modeling internationally. Later the models pose beachside in Op bikinis for a spread in the June/July 2006 issue of ElleGirl magazine and Amp'd Mobile, photographed by judge Nigel Barker.

Created by Tyra Banks, America's Next Top Model follows a group of young women of various backgrounds, shapes and sizes who live together in a loft and vie for a modeling contract.
The show exposes the transformation of everyday young women into potentially fierce supermodels, with participants facing weekly tests that determine who can make the cut. With mentoring by supermodel Tyra Banks and exposure to high-profile fashion-industry gurus, the finalists compete in a highly accelerated modeling boot camp - a crash course to supermodel fame.
